Role summary

Kyriba is embarking on a greenfield implementation of Workday Financials. The Workday Finance Lead will be our internal functional leader through deployment, partnering closely with our implementation partner to deliver a global rollout.

Post go-live (target 2027), the Workday Finance Lead will own the functional roadmap and ongoing optimization of Finance, Expenses, and Procurement in Workday across all Kyriba legal entities, driving automation, controls, and real-time insight.

What you'll do

Project phase (Implementation)
  • Functional leadership: Serve as Kyriba's primary functional voice across Workday Core Financials, Procurement, and Expenses; represent business requirements, validate partner designs, and steward global design decisions and localization patterns.
  • Global design: Partner with the implementation team on FDM/Chart of Accounts, fiscal calendars, multi-entity, and multi-currency; review and approve intercompany, consolidation, and tax design recommendations with Controllership.
  • Data and legacy migration: Co-own data readiness and integrity; define acceptance criteria and reconciliation rules, lead mapping reviews, and sign off on conversion outcomes as part of legacy decommissioning.
  • Compliance and localization: Coordinate with Tax and local Finance to ensure proposed designs meet e-invoicing mandates and statutory requirements.
  • Process consulting: Lead Kyriba-side workshops with Finance COEs for P2P, O2C, and R2R; synthesize requirements, prioritize trade-offs, and provide decision records to guide the implementation partner's scalable design.
  • Testing and quality: Define test strategy and scenarios; oversee SIT/UAT execution and defect triage with the partner; manage cutover readiness criteria and hypercare success measures on behalf of Finance.

About Kyriba Corporation

Kyriba is a cloud-based treasury, cash and risk management solutions provider. The company offers a suite of solutions designed to help CFOs and finance teams optimize their cash, manage their risk, and work their capital. Kyriba's solutions include cash management, payments, supply chain finance, hedge accounting, risk management, and more. The company serves over 2,000 clients worldwide, including many Fortune 500 companies.
